Добро пожаловать в форум, Guest  >>   Войти | Регистрация | Поиск | Правила | В избранное | Подписаться
Все форумы / Microsoft SQL Server Новый топик    Ответить
 растет лог  [new]
Вапрос
Guest
Есть база с моделью восстановления simple.
есть одна транзакция по зиливке данных - точно известно ,что пока транзакция не завершится лог вырастет на +10гиг, после чего сам усекается..
если кильнуть процесс заливки , пойдет процесс rollback - что приводит к размеру +20 гиг и после отката - усекается ....почему так ? лог логирует откат ?
26 авг 09, 17:57    [7583522]     Ответить | Цитировать Сообщить модератору
 Re: растет лог  [new]
pkarklin
Member

Откуда: Москва (Муром)
Сообщений: 74927
автор
лог логирует откат ?


А Вы полагаете, что откат - это удаление наката? Лог всегда пишется в конец.
26 авг 09, 18:01    [7583556]     Ответить | Цитировать Сообщить модератору
 Re: растет лог  [new]
Maxx
Member [скрыт]

Откуда:
Сообщений: 24290
-------------------------------------
Jedem Das Seine
26 авг 09, 18:11    [7583630]     Ответить | Цитировать Сообщить модератору
 Re: растет лог  [new]
Ozerov
Member

Откуда: Москва
Сообщений: 3650
Вапрос
после чего сам усекается..

Еще и шринк лога стоит в конце транзакции ? :)
26 авг 09, 18:14    [7583648]     Ответить | Цитировать Сообщить модератору
 Re: растет лог  [new]
Алексей2003
Member

Откуда: Москва
Сообщений: 5645
2Вапрос
записывается 10 гигов. пишется ролл бэк. откатилось 5гигов информации. тут вырубается свет. при включении SQL Serverа что откатывать?

для спящего время бодрствования равносильно сну
26 авг 09, 18:24    [7583720]     Ответить | Цитировать Сообщить модератору
 Re: растет лог  [new]
erererererу1
Guest
да лог логирует откат - если так угодно. например вы сделали изменений на 10 Гб - это отражено в логе, потом вы эти изменения хотите убрать - естественно эти транзакции будут отражены в логе. это массовые операции наверное у вас. не шринкуйте лог в конце - пусть он у вас +10 всегда будет
26 авг 09, 18:26    [7583728]     Ответить | Цитировать Сообщить модератору
 Re: растет лог  [new]
Критик
Member

Откуда: Москва / Калуга
Сообщений: 33364
Блог
Возможно, допустимо будет разбить вашу большую транзакцию на несколько сот маленьких.
26 авг 09, 19:47    [7583962]     Ответить | Цитировать Сообщить модератору
Все форумы / Microsoft SQL Server Ответить